MEMORANDUM TO: FROM: Mayor and City Council Michele MCPherso~ector of Planning DATE: August I 5, 2005 SUBJECT: Case No. P 05-12 Request by the Elk River Economic Development Authority for Final Plat of Northstar Business Park Request The Elk River Economic Development Authority requests consideration of a final plat for Northstar Business Park. Location West of Twin Lakes Road at 175m Avenue, south of Elk River Business Park Zoningl Land Use BP Business Park/LI Light Industrial Attachments . Location Map · Resolution No. 05 - . Preliminary Plat . Preliminary Grading Plan . Final Plat Analysis The subject property has a number of site constraints which will make development of the site complicated. The site is crossed in several directions by utility easements; one for overhead electric lines; another for underground natural gas. The westerly one-half of the site is comprised of wedand and detention pond, resulting in approximately 45 developable acres. The preliminary plat was comprised of six buildable lots from 2.39 to 13.11 acres in area and an oudot which will contain the wedand area. The final plat is consistent with the preliminary plat. One road will be constructed with a full access at the intersection of 175th Avenue and Twin Lakes Road, and with a right-in right-out intersection north of 175th Avenue. Grading and Drainage The City Engineer has prepared a preliminary grading plan which complies with the City's drainage standards. No wedand impacts will result as development of the site. Surface water management fees will be paid at the time of final plat recording. Park Dedication The Parks and Recreation Commission recommended cash for the developable acres at $2,000 per acre. They also requested an easement for trail purposes over Oudot A to allow construction of trails for multi-purposes. The 2ity Council, in approving the preliminary plat, removed the condition for trail easement dedication. Recommendation Staff recommends that the City Council approve the resolution for final plat approval for N orthstar Business Park with the following conditions: 1. SURFACE WATER MANAGEMENT FEE BE PAID IN THE AMOUNT REQUIRED BY THE CITY AT THE TIME OF FINAL PLAT PRIOR TO RELEASING THE PLAT FOR RECORDING. 2. CASH SHALL BE PAID FOR PARK DEDICATION FOR THE DEVELOPABLE ACRES.
